Shubham Tulsiani is an Assistant Professor at Carnegie Mellon University's Robotics Institute, where he leads the Computer Vision group and the Physical Perception Lab. His research focuses on inferring physically and spatially grounded representations from perceptual inputs, with applications in 3D vision, robot manipulation, and neural scene reconstruction. He directs an active research group with multiple PhD and Master's students. Research interests center on 3D scene understanding , robot learning , and generative modeling , with specific emphasis on: self-supervised perception, neural rendering, multi-view geometry, manipulation from visual inputs, and physics-based reasoning. The lab develops methods that leverage physical world constraints as supervisory signals. Recent publications demonstrate strong focus on diffusion models for 3D tasks , sparse-view reconstruction , and robotic manipulation transfer . Key trends include neural inverse rendering, view synthesis from limited observations, and translating human interactions to robot actions. Awards include: Best Student Paper Award at CVPR 2015 Advising includes supervision of 5 PhD students, 4 MS students, and undergraduates. Lab alumni hold positions at Google, Stanford, Meta, and Princeton. The Physical Perception Lab collaborates with FAIR Pittsburgh and the CMU Computer Vision group.
